Understanding DTF Technology The Technical Breakdown

DTF printing is an cutting-edge digital printing method that uses creating designs on unique PET film using aqueous inks and hot-melt powder. Unlike traditional printing methods, DTF transfers can be used on cotton, polyester, nylon, leather, and blended fabrics without pretreatment. This adaptability makes DTF printer technology extremely desirable among companies looking for effective, premium printing alternatives.

The technique generates prints that are not only aesthetically impressive but also exceptionally resilient. DTF transfers withstand cracking, peeling, and fading even after multiple washes, making them excellent for business use where durability is essential. With the capacity to reproduce detailed artwork, gradients, and lifelike pictures, DTF printing opens up infinite creative opportunities for your business.

How to Create DTF Transfers: Complete Tutorial

Producing high-end DTF transfers requires knowing each stage of the procedure. Here's a thorough breakdown:

1. Artwork Development

First designing your artwork using professional software like Adobe Photoshop, Illustrator, or accessible programs like Canva or Procreate. Output your design as a high-resolution PNG file with a transparent background. The advantage of DTF printing is that you can work with complex, multi-colored designs without worrying about color limitations.

2. Creating the Transfer

Load your design into the DTF printer software. The printer will first deposit the color layers (CMYK) directly onto the PET film, subsequently applying a white ink layer that functions as a base. This white layer is crucial for achieving vivid tones on dark fabrics. Latest DTF printer models can reach speeds of up to high production rates, making them perfect for high-volume production.

3. Applying Adhesive Powder

As the ink is still wet, uniformly spread hot-melt adhesive powder over the entire printed design. This powder is what bonds the DTF transfer to the fabric during application. Use a see-saw motion to guarantee complete coverage, then shake off any excess powder. Many businesses are now acquiring automated powder shakers for reliable results.

4. Curing the Transfer

The adhesive powder needs to be thermally set before application. This can be done using a heat tunnel (recommended for best practices) or by hovering under a heat press. Curing usually takes 60-90 seconds in an oven at the appropriate temperature. Correct curing allows your DTF transfers can be preserved for later use or transferred immediately.

5. Applying to Garment

Initially press your garment for brief moment to remove moisture and wrinkles. Place your DTF transfer on the fabric and press at appropriate temperature for optimal duration with balanced pressure. The heat engages the adhesive, establishing a permanent bond between the design and fabric.

6. Peeling and Final Press

After pressing, peel the film while it's still warm in one fluid movement. This hot-peel process delivers sharp details and eliminates unwanted lines in your design. To finish, perform a second press for another 10-15 seconds to boost durability and decrease shine.

The Rise of DTF Technology the Market in 2025

The DTF printing market has witnessed remarkable expansion, valued at nearly $3 billion in 2024 and expected to reach impressive heights by 2030. This outstanding expansion is powered by several key factors:

Exceptional Adaptability

Compared to other printing processes, DTF transfers work on nearly all fabric material without pre-treatment. From 100% cotton to artificial fabrics, leather to nylon, DTF printing delivers uniform, professional results across all surfaces.

Any Volume Production

If you require a single piece or bulk orders, DTF printer technology eliminates setup costs and order minimums. This versatility makes it perfect for print-on-demand, personalized orders, and design experimentation without financial risk.

Exceptional Output

Contemporary DTF printing produces exceptionally sharp, bright graphics that equal or beat standard processes. The technology performs best with creating photo-realistic designs, complex gradients, and fine details that would be difficult with alternative techniques.

Economic Efficiency

With reduced initial investment than screen printing and faster production than DTG printing, DTF transfers deliver an excellent profit potential. The capability to combine various graphics on a one film additionally minimizes costs and supply usage.

Required Tools for Successful Operations

To begin your DTF printing venture, you'll want the following tools:

  • Transfer Printer: Choose from dedicated machines by brands like Epson, Roland, and Mimaki, or convert existing printers for DTF printing
  • Transfer Inks: Formulated textile inks developed for maximum adhesion and color vibrancy
  • Transfer Film: Offered as rolls or sheets, with temperature-specific options
  • Bonding Powder: Standard powder for most applications, black for dark designs on dark fabrics
  • Heat Press: Industrial press with consistent temperature and pressure
  • Curing Oven: For optimal powder curing (essential)
  • Print Software: For color management and result improvement
